I'm spending more and more of my time in this part of the world and the site is only 20 odd minutes away. They have use of 4 sites, well it will be 4 soon, and The Big One is a fairly dense woodland. The part that we played on today was about 2 acres, which is fine as there were only 20 players. The first play was sort of a standard domination game. There were numerous poles, with a tube that slides on it. It was coloured with red and yellow, our team colours, and you had to have your colour pointing up. Who ever has the most poles displaying their colour wins. I've no idea who won, I was just really enjoying the game, the communication, the hit calling and the terrain. As it is in Lincolnshire, its reasonably flat, ish! I like flat, I'm too old and fat to be running up and down hills. I played at Sixmill near Rugeley a few weeks ago and it was an amazing site but with 140 odd players and a large site on the side of a hill, I was soon knackered amd lost. I did manage to wander, because I was lost, behind the enemy position and got close enough to a sniper to ask him if he wanted to take the hit, or the shot. He took the hit. 😁 Anyway, second game was an attack and defend where we, the attacking team, had to get 2 jerry cans into a crater that the red team where defending. 10 second medic and 60 second bleed out where in play. I'd love to say that we got close but we didn't. The defenders were dug in to some proper cracking spots and we just couldn't get close. Again, really good terrain and excellent game play from both teams. I did get shot in the side, a few minutes, after game end at one point as he hadn't heard the end command!
